Waste Removal for Retailers: Managing Excess Inventory

Posted by Erin Richardson on October 13th, 2023

Excess inventory is a common challenge for retailers, leading to a range of logistical and financial issues. Properly managing surplus stock is crucial for maintaining efficient operations and maximizing profits. 1. Efficient Inventory Management:

Retailers often encounter situations where stock levels exceed consumer demand. Excess inventory occupies valuable storage space and can lead to financial losses. 4. Avoiding Obsolescence:

Inventory that becomes obsolete due to changes in consumer preferences or technology advancements can result in substantial financial losses. Waste removal services assist retailers in swiftly disposing of obsolete products, mitigating financial risks.
